These amenities are exclusive to Royal Caribbean and are all found aboard the Oasis of the Seas Royal Caribbean. Plus, experience an ice skating rink, a rare feature.
The Oasis of the Seas Royal Caribbean also offers a minigolf course, a spa, a gym, a casino, a solarium, a waterslide, and eleven jacuzzis.
